106214195 has 4 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 127457040. Its totient is φ = 84971352.

The previous prime is 106214191. The next prime is 106214221. The reversal of 106214195 is 591412601.

It is a semiprime because it is the product of two primes.

It is a cyclic number.

It is not a de Polignac number, because 106214195 - 22 = 106214191 is a prime.

It is a super-2 number, since 2×1062141952 = 22562910438996050, which contains 22 as substring.

It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(106214191) by changing a digit.

It is a polite number, since it can be written in 3 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 10621415 + ... + 10621424.

It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(31864260).

Almost surely, 2106214195 is an apocalyptic number.

106214195 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(21242845).

106214195 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.

106214195 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.

The sum of its prime factors is 21242844.

The product of its (nonzero) digits is 2160, while the sum is 29.

The square root of 106214195 is about 10306.0271200885. The cubic root of 106214195 is about 473.5809095736.

Adding to 106214195 its reverse (591412601), we get a palindrome (697626796).

The spelling of 106214195 in words is "one hundred six million, two hundred fourteen thousand, one hundred ninety-five".

Divisors: 1 5 21242839 106214195
